Genetics of Calico Cats
To understand why male calico cats are rare and may have health issues, it’s essential to grasp the basic genetics of calico cats. The calico coloring is a result of a specific combination of genes that determine the production of the melanin pigment, which is responsible for hair color. The genes that control coat color are located on the X chromosome, one of the two sex chromosomes in cats. Female mammals, including cats, have two X chromosomes (XX), while males have one X and one Y chromosome (XY).
X-Chromosome and Color Determination
The X chromosome carries the genes that determine the color of a cat’s coat. For a cat to have a calico coat, it needs to have two X chromosomes, each carrying a different version of the gene that controls the production of melanin. One X chromosome carries the gene for black coat color, and the other carries the gene for orange coat color. This combination results in the characteristic white, black, and orange patches of a calico cat. Since male cats have only one X chromosome, they can be either black or orange but not calico, as they lack the second X chromosome needed for the calico coloring.
Klinefelter Syndrome in Male Calico Cats
Male calico cats are rare because they need to have an extra X chromosome to display the calico color pattern. This extra X chromosome is a result of a genetic condition known as Klinefelter Syndrome, where a male cat is born with XXY chromosomes instead of the usual XY. This condition is rare in cats, occurring in about 1 in every 3,000 male cats. Klinefelter Syndrome is the key reason why male calico cats can exist, but it also poses health risks for these cats.
Health Issues in Male Calico Cats
Male calico cats, due to their genetic makeup, are more prone to certain health issues compared to their female counterparts. The presence of an extra X chromosome can lead to various health problems, ranging from reproductive issues to increased susceptibility to certain diseases.
Reproductive Issues
One of the most significant health issues in male calico cats is related to their reproductive system. Cats with Klinefelter Syndrome often have underdeveloped testes, which can lead to infertility. Male calico cats are usually sterile, meaning they are unable to reproduce. This aspect, while not directly affecting their quality of life, is an important consideration for owners who might be interested in breeding their cats.

What is the genetic basis of male calico cats?
The genetic basis of male calico cats is a result of a rare genetic condition. Normally, the gene that determines the color of a cat’s fur is located on the X chromosome. Female mammals, including cats, have two X chromosomes, while males have one X and one Y chromosome. The calico coloration is the result of a specific combination of genes on the X chromosome that create the distinctive orange and black patches. In female calico cats, this is achieved by having one X chromosome with the gene for black fur and another X chromosome with the gene for orange fur.
For a male cat to be calico, it must have two X chromosomes, which is a rare genetic condition known as Klinefelter syndrome. This occurs when a male cat has an extra X chromosome, resulting in an XXY genetic makeup instead of the typical XY. This extra X chromosome allows the male cat to express the calico coloration, but it also often leads to other health issues. Male calico cats with Klinefelter syndrome may experience a range of health problems, including infertility, increased risk of certain cancers, and cardiovascular issues.
Are male calico cats always sterile?
Male calico cats are often sterile due to the genetic condition that causes their calico coloration. As mentioned earlier, male calico cats typically have an extra X chromosome, resulting in Klinefelter syndrome. This condition can affect the development of the testes and lead to infertility. In many cases, male calico cats are unable to produce viable sperm, making them sterile. However, it’s essential to note that not all male calico cats are sterile, and some may still be able to reproduce.
The fertility of a male calico cat depends on the specific genetic factors at play. While many male calico cats with Klinefelter syndrome are sterile, some may still be able to father offspring. If you’re considering breeding a male calico cat, it’s crucial to have him tested for fertility and to work with a reputable breeder who can help you understand the potential risks and challenges. Additionally, even if a male calico cat is fertile, breeding him may not be recommended due to the potential health risks associated with Klinefelter syndrome.
